Analysis

The most recent figure for commercial service exports (current us$), per square kilometre in Faroe Islands is 148,143 current US$ per square kilometre, measured in 2011.

The figure is up 8.5% on the previous year and up 264.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, commercial service exports (current us$), per square kilometre in Faroe Islands peaked at 180,431 current US$ per square kilometre in 2008 and was at its lowest, 36,547 current US$ per square kilometre, in 1998.

Faroe Islands ranks 72nd of 198 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Commercial service exports (current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Commercial service exports (current US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
